Ψ is a structure→property intelligence. It does not simulate a beaker — it maps molecular structure into a shared descriptor space, places the result on capability axes, and measures how far a whole formulation sits from what its peptide actually needs. Four pillars carry the weight.
The W6 "Mendeleev" engine takes a canonical SMILES and derives a 26-dimensional descriptor vector Φ — electrostatics, hydrophobic patterning, chemical liability, solid-state behaviour — then maps Φ onto capability axes Λ with a ridge-NNLS model calibrated on 27 curated anchor substances. 68 of 101 periodic-table entries are derived this way.
A formulation is a set, not a molecule. Ψ combines every ingredient's effective capability into Λ_S and scores the shortfall Δ, the harmful overshoot C⁻ and the oversupply E against the peptide's need vector N — with β > α, so doing harm costs more than falling short. The score maps through 100 × e−Ψ/τ with τ = 0.615.
A display-only sidecar computes frontier-orbital descriptors — HOMO, LUMO, gap, ionisation potential, electron affinity — using a real GFN2-xTB backend (xtb 6.7.1, run as a subprocess with hard timeouts and typed failure states). Empirical RDKit descriptors and SMARTS-based proxies are labelled as exactly what they are.
W7 treats every literature prior as a Beta distribution and updates it conjugately with each real Panacea run — posteriors live in an overlay, frozen literature priors are never mutated, and the 90% credible interval is the headline number. Certainty is earned run by run, never asserted.

A number you cannot defend is worse than no number. Ψ is built so that false certainty is structurally impossible — three mechanisms do the work, and the full doctrine lives on the Honesty page.
Unresolvable structure, ambiguous identity, missing quantum backend, uncurated biological reference set — each returns a typed decline with the reason attached. The system says "I cannot know this" in the same voice it says everything else. Never a fabricated number.
The known-space distance gate measures how far a substance sits from the 27 curated anchors in descriptor space. Farther away means a harder ceiling on certainty — down to a 0.15 cap for structurally alien substances. Novelty automatically deflates the readout.
The entire Ψ spine is isolated from the formulation engine: it writes nothing, applies nothing, mutates no seed and touches no actuator. Ψ informs the operator; the operator — and only the operator — decides.
Every number carries its provenance: literature prior, derived-from-structure, or bench-calibrated from real Panacea runs. The label travels with the value wherever it is shown.

Panacea Bio Chem's formulation-compatibility objective: every substance is reduced to a capability vector, a recipe's needs become a need vector, and Ψ measures the squared distance between them. The score is 100 × e−Ψ/τ.
Through the W6 Mendeleev engine: canonical SMILES → 26-dimensional descriptor vector → ridge-NNLS mapping calibrated on 27 curated anchors. Unresolvable structures get a typed decline, never a guessed vector.
Yes — a display-only sidecar computes HOMO/LUMO and derived quantities with a real GFN2-xTB backend (xtb 6.7.1). Without a backend or a structure, those fields are honest declines, not numbers.
